Exgungment
If your case was dismissed or no billed by the State Attorney and you have not previously had a case expunged you should qualify to expunge your case. This means that the arrest will be off your record and almost everyone will never see it again. Even after a case is dropped the arrest will still show on your record forever!!! This is especially important in today's workforce where employers are looking up arrest history.
Sealing
If you are found guilty or you take a plea and you get a withhold of adjudication and it is your first offense you may be able to get your record sealed. There are come charges like Domestic Violence Battery that if you take a plea to may not be sealed, that is why it is important to fight those charges in court. But most charges can be sealed which means that the arrest and case will not show up the the average employer or person
